What they do
A Janitor or Cleaner provides cleaning and basic maintenance in buildings such as schools, offices, stores, hospitals or hotels. Cleans and polishes floors, removes trash, vacuums carpets, washes windows, cleans bathrooms, stocks building supplies such as light bulbs and paper towels and performs minor repairs as needed. Holds keys for rooms and building entrances and locks or unlocks them as needed.
$34,013 / year median in Wisconsin
+2% projected growth
Job Description
Job Summary:
We are se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Office Cleaner to join our team. As an Office Cleaner, you will be responsible for maintaining the cleanliness and overall appearance of our office facilities. This is a vital role in ensuring a clean and safe environment for our employees and visitors.Duties:
- Perform general cleaning tasks, including dusting, sweeping, mopping, and vacuuming
- Clean and sanitize restrooms, including toilets, sinks, and mirrors
- Empty trash cans and replace liners
- Clean windows, glass surfaces, and mirrors
- Maintain cleanliness of common areas such as break rooms and conference rooms
- Restock supplies in restrooms and other areas as needed
- Follow established cleaning procedures and safety guidelines
- Assist with other custodial tasks as assigned
Requirements:
- Previous experience in cleaning or janitorial services preferred
- Knowledge of proper cleaning techniques and use of cleaning equipment
-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
- Strong attention to detail and ability to prioritize tasks
- Good physical stamina to perform repetitive tasks and lift heavy objects if necessary
- Excellent time management skills to ensure all cleaning duties are completed within designated timeframes
Skills:
- Ability to maintain a clean and organized work environment Hours can be flexible to be determined by Plant Manager with an average of 6-8 hours a week .
